Description
Supirocin-B Plus Ointment is a combination of Beclomethasone and Mupirocin. It is used for the treatment of bacterial skin infections. Mupirocin works by killing the infection-causing bacteria and preventing further bacterial growth. Beclomethasone works by blocking certain chemicals responsible for redness, swelling, and itching at the site of infection and provides relief. Supirocin-B Plus Ointment may cause burning sensation, itching, redness, and dryness at the site of application. Consult your doctor if these symptoms persist or if they become severe. Supirocin-B Plus Ointment should be applied topically on the affected part of your skin as directed by your doctor. Continue using the medicine for the prescribed duration to reduce your risk of re-infection. Supirocin-B Plus Ointment should be avoided if you are allergic to it. Consult your doctor if you are pregnant or are breastfeeding.

General warnings

Antibiotic resistance

Antibiotic resistance is a condition where infection-causing organisms develop the ability to defeat the effect of drugs designed to kill them. Hence, to avoid such resistance, you should always complete the entire course of treatment with Supirocin-B Plus Ointment as prescribed by your doctor.

External use only

Supirocin-B Plus Ointment is meant for external use only. Avoid contact with your eyes. In case of accidental contact with your eyes, rinse thoroughly with water. Seek immediate medical help in case of accidental ingestion.

Other medicines

Supirocin-B Plus Ointment may interact with other medicines meant for topical use. Inform your doctor about all the topical preparations (ointments/lotions/gels) that you may have been using to avoid undesired side effects.

How it works
Supirocin-B Plus Ointment is a combination of Beclomethasone and Mupirocin. Beclomethasone is a corticosteroid. It works by decreasing the formation of certain chemical substances in your body that are responsible for causing redness, swelling, and itching of the affected part of your skin. Mupirocin is an antibiotic that works by inhibiting bacterial protein synthesis. This prevents cell growth and eventually kills the bacteria.
